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
205b Long Ln. Bexleyheath, Greater London, United Kingdom, DA7 5AF
31 Oldbury Plc. Westminster Abbey, London, United Kingdom, W1U 5PT
8 Hylands Rd. Waltham Forest, London, United Kingdom, E17 4AL
2 Purley Way Croydon, Greater London, United Kingdom, CR0 3JP
2 Hartfield Crst. Wimbledon, London, United Kingdom, SW19 3SD
Brooks Way Sevenoaks Way, Saint Paul's Cray Orpington, Greater London, United Kingdom, BR5 3BB
Unit 1, Brooks Way, Sevenoaks Way Orpington, Greater London, United Kingdom, BR5 3BB
4 Maybank Rd. South Woodford, Greater London, United Kingdom, E18 1EJ
Enterprise House, Blyth Rd. Hayes, Greater London, United Kingdom, UB3 1DD
194 Mozart Terrace, Ebury St. Westminster Abbey, London, United Kingdom, SW1W 8UP